Before diving into the films, one must understand the cultural raw material. Kerala is an anomaly in India. It boasts the highest literacy rate, a matrilineal history in certain communities, a robust public health system, a syncretic culture where Hindus, Muslims, and Christians coexist with unique local flavors, and the highest per capita consumption of alcohol and gold. It is a land of communists who pray in temples and Christians who join Hindu festivals.

For decades, the traditional ancestral home ( Tharavad ) served as the epicenter of Malayalam film narratives. Movies in the 1970s and 1980s frequently explored the decline of the matrilineal feudal system ( Marumakkathayam ). These films captured the anxieties of upper-caste families losing their land holding privileges, juxtaposed against the rising working class. The lush green paddy fields, monsoon rains, and winding backwaters provided a visual poetry that became synonymous with the Kerala aesthetic. The tradition of Vishu , the Malayalam New Year, also serves as a major release season. Even during the COVID-19 pandemic in 2020, the release of three Onam films on OTT platforms highlighted how integral the festival has become to the industry’s calendar. This close relationship turns major holidays into shared cultural experiences, where watching a new film with family is as integral to the celebration as the Onam sadya (traditional feast) or buying new clothes.
